My chrome powders finally arrived yesterday so I had a play about with them. Got mine from eBay. Didn't want to spend too much before I practiced! I don't have a no wipe topcoat though but it worked ok. Do you really need no wipe topcoat? Coco, I see you use a normal one, what's your steps?
I did:

Base coat- cure
Black gel- cure
Black gel- cure
Top coat- cure
Wipe off inhibition layer
Work in chrome powder
Top coat- cure
 
I use my normal top coat and have no issues, I topcoat and wipe inhabition layer with a dry piece of kitchen roll ( no d sperse ) then chrome powder and topcoat twice.
